**14:22 — Skew confirmed between agents brindle-03 and brindle-07.**

Artifacts compiled on brindle-07 carried timestamps eleven seconds ahead, causing the Larchmont pipeline to treat fresh outputs as stale and skip packaging. Reviewer note: the comparison logic trusts mtime directly; see the proposed hash-based check. The affected build's token is recorded below.

pipeline stamp: htk3_a71

The Tilecrow map-tile prefetcher keeps two stores. Hot tiles live in an in-memory cache on each worker and are evicted after six hours. Tile metadata — zoom level, region hash, last-fetched timestamp — lives in the planning database, which the scheduler queries every ten minutes to decide what to prefetch next. Contractors should never write to the metadata tables directly; use the admin CLI instead. For read-only inspection, the scheduler connects to the planning database with the following connection string.

warehouse DSN: mssql://rusdor_svc:0FSWCn9@db-951a.paliqforge.local:5432/ulawyn

During the migration from the legacy Ironvale badge system to the new Cresswick readers, all visitors to the Penhallow building must be escorted by facilities staff at every turnstile. Legacy badges will stop working floor by floor, so check the weekly cutover sheet before issuing passes. Until the migration completes, escorts should use the interim override code listed below.

turnstile pass: bdg-QZV-3

## Handover: Driver assignment heuristic

The Rovana dispatcher now weights driver proximity against shift-remaining time instead of raw distance. The scoring function lives in the assignment module; the greedy pass runs before the swap-improvement pass. Watch for starvation on long routes — the penalty term handles it but is sensitive to tuning. The values currently deployed in staging are listed below.

settings of tagef-bawif:
DRUIX_HOST=druix.zemvarlabs.internal
DRUIX_PORT=8000